Overview

Xavier M. Thomas began working as a clerk at Joe M. Reed & Associates, LLC in August 2021.

In 2022, he joined the firm as an Associate Attorney. Xavier currently represents a variety of criminal defendants facing a wide range of criminal charges and plaintiffs in personal injury litigation.

Background

Xavier is a native of Livingston, Alabama, and attended the University of West Alabama, earning a Bachelor of Science in Integrated Marketing Communications in 2018. After completing his undergraduate education, Xavier attended Faulkner University Thomas Goode Jones School of Law and earned his Juris Doctorate in 2022. While in law school, Xavier was a member of the National Trial Team and served as the Director of Sub-Region 1 for the Southern Region of the National Black Law Students Association. Xavier also was a two-time Magic City Bar Association Scholarship Award Recipient and a Greg Allen Trial Competition Semi-Finalist. Additionally, Xavier clerked for Legal Services Alabama, which provided legal representation in civil matters to the underserved, and clerked for the District Attorney’s Office for the Sixth Judicial Circuit.

How do I choose a lawyer?

Consider the following:

  • Comfort Level – Are you comfortable telling the lawyer personal information? Does the lawyer seem interested in solving your problem?
  • Credentials – How long has the lawyer been in practice? Has the lawyer worked on other cases similar to yours?
  • Cost – How are the lawyer's fees structured — hourly or flat fee? Can the lawyer estimate the cost of your case?
  • City – Is the lawyer's office conveniently located?

Want to check lawyer discipline?

It is always a good idea to research your lawyer prior to hiring. Every state has a disciplinary organization that monitors attorneys, their licenses, and consumer complaints. By researching lawyer discipline you can:

  • Ensure the attorney is currently licensed to practice in your state
  • Gain an understanding of his or her historical disciplinary record, if any.
  • Determine the seriousness of complaints/issues which could range from late bar fees to more serious issues requiring disciplinary action.
